Alright, I know I should be able to do this, but unfortunately I entered the mines without the identify spell. Now I can't get the unknown scroll (miners writ) to work. What can I do? I have killed the Stout King and now if I don't get out of here soon I'm going to go nuts if I don't get killed.

kev 08-23-2002 12:58 AM

Maybe you are using the wrong unknown scroll. When you used the scroll to enter the mine odds are that it was returned to the wrong charactor. Try looking at all your charactors for an unknown scroll, that could be it.

the_young_one 08-23-2002 02:20 AM

The scroll is normally returned to your first character (the one on top left) regardless as to who was talking. It appears as an unkown scroll..

The absolute last resort would be to play around with the carts until you find the right one to go to the guardroom, dispose of the guard and press the switch yourself.

Also, even if you can't identify the writ, you can still read it. Find the writ and then put it in the box to get out.

I've usually had it returned to the first character in the party, regardless of who actually gave it to him.

You don't need to identify the writ to be able to use it. As already mentioned, you can read it to know which of the various unknown scrolls you have is actually the writ. The default is for the guard to give it to the first character in line, if that inventory is full it should end up in the second character's inventory, etc.

actually, it is quite easy 2 indentify the miner's writ PHYSICALLY without reading it. the other normal spell-casting scrolls look like neat straight letters, whereas the miner's writ, as it is special, it will look like a curved n crumpled piece of paper wif the red ribbon around it......
as other scrolls may look like this, you should read all the scrolls taht look likt the 1 i described. this is to help quicken your search!
